Re: How to remove video thumbail from production screen?
The log shows that SCS can see only one screen. That's why the videos are being displayed in that panel on the main screen. To use a second screen or projector, make sure the screen or projector is connected and switched on before starting SCS. Also, the second screen or projector must be configured in Windows as an extension of the desktop.
